The internal document shows that fewer than 90 of those detained were labeled as “criminal aliens,” despite administration statements describing the operation as focused on individuals with criminal histories.
Mecklenburg County, which includes Charlotte, does not honor ICE detainers, and the city police department does not participate in immigration enforcement.
The administration has pointed to the fatal light-rail stabbing of Ukrainian refugee Iryna Zarutska as evidence that the city is not protecting residents.
